Brookline Police Bank Robbery Suspect in Red Sox Shirt Still on the Run

Anyone with information on this "most wanted" suspect is asked to call Brookline police at 617-730-2222.

Police are still on the hunt for a Brookline bank robbery suspect.

On June 5, the suspect allegedly robbed Santander Bank on Harvard Street. He had a “weak” beard and was wearing a Boston Red Sox shirt.

The suspect was described as a Hispanic male, about 30 years old, and standing at least 5 feet, 8 inches with a heavy build.

“He had a light goatee with a weak attempt to grow a beard along the jaw line,” police said in a statement.

Police said the suspect passed a note to a teller but didn’t show a weapon.
